Shouldn't the Release tag include the git hash? There seems to be no released version.

+ package name is OK
? license is acceptable (MIT)
? license is not specified correctly
Where did you see the MIT license? README.md says this is derived from http://code.google.com/p/mahonia/, which lists BSD 3-clause.

Either way, you should open a ticket upstream asking for a license file to be included. Actually adding the license file is not necessary, but the ticket should be opened according to the guidelines [https://fedoraproject.org/wiki/Packaging:LicensingGuidelines#License_Text].
